I saw the new animated movie UP the other day, and it was really good. It was a mix of funny moment and some a bit more serious/sad...


What really surprised me was the beginning, the story of the old man. Although it started as a fairy tale (marrying his childhood friend) soon enough things started to go bad. I’m not saying this kind of beginning is bad, just very unexpected. Unexpected is good dough, nowadays there are so many movies, that we usually know what’s coming up next.

What I really like was how, in some ways, it became a parody of other movies, without being ridiculous. My favourite part must have been the fight between the two old men, using their false teeth to attack each other, or readying themselves to strike their adversaries until their back got stuck.

One thing really deceived me. I saw the ad for the movie like two weeks before it was going to be realesed, and it was a scene of the movie. Actually the little guy, with his scout “training ” wanted to apply a Band Aid to the old man’s finger (a wound no bigger than a paper cut!!) But he didn’t know how to apply it, the little guy was READING the instructions on the box and having a hard time. (Took him like ten Band Aid to success). Any ways it was really fun to see, and it convinced me to go see the movie, unfortunately this scene never made it to the actual cut. I am kind of made about that, like doing some sort of false publicity, showing me something, taunting me, and not giving it... It better be put in the bonuses of the.

Lastly there is only one thing that I haven’t been able to decide on, whether it really is a “kids” movie. I found that some theme in it might be hard to understand for some younger kids, and they might find the movie a bit boring. At least it’s the impression I got while watching the movie, the young kids didn’t seem really enthusiast...
